In 1909, Roy John Croft entered the world in St. Louis, Minnesota, USA, born to John Jack Croft And Jennie Emily Norgren. In 1910, Roy John Croft resided in Duluth, Saint Louis, Minnesota, USA. In 1920, Roy John Croft resided in Rosebush, Cook, Minnesota, USA. Roy John Croft married Ingrid Helen Larsen, and had children including Baby Girl Croft, Donna Jean Croft. Roy John Croft passed away in 1969 in Grand Marais, Cook, Minnesota, USA.
